How Lenders Determine Your Maximum Mortgage – So if your monthly income is $10,000 and your total house payment is $2,500, your top or front end ratio is 25%. Add your other expenses–a couple of car payments at $400 each and a $200 in credit card payments–to your housing for a total of $3,500 a month, and you have a back or bottom end ratio of 35%.

If you do not qualify for an FHA secured loan, and have an LTV of over 80% (less than 20% deposit), then the bank will usually require private mortgage insurance (PMI) on your mortgage. This is the private sector equivalent of FHA secured loans.
